The Bunch of Grapes
Thomas May issued this trade token, worth a half penny, for his business at the sign of the Bunch of Grapes, in Rotherhithe, Surrey.
Boyne & Williamson (1891) reference Surrey number 270; Obv inscription: THOMAS. MAY .AT. YE. BVNCH. OF (around field, in Roman capitals) Device = A bunch of grapes (in field); Rev inscription: GRAPES.IN.REDERIFE.1669 (around field, in Roman capitals) Device = HIS / HALF / PENY / T.E.M. (in four lines of Roman capitals with triad of initials as bottom, in field).
Rotherhithe formerly formed part of Surrey, it now lies within the London Borough of Southwark.
